Iframe will hold the specified ratio when page is rescaled.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>[rframe ratio=”16×9″ src=”http:\u002F\u002Fflixel.com\u002Fplayer\u002Fsnqi608mlq1h98w5p9jy” width=”60%” \u002F]\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Ch4>How it Works\u003C\u002Fh4>\n\u003Cp>DIV block with specified width is creted. Inside is transparent PNG file with specifed ratio scaled to 100% width and height set to auto. This image will scale the main DIV to size with correct ratio.\u003Cbr \u002F>\nEmbeded IFRAME is then set to fill the wrapper DIV, so it is scaled with the image.\u003Cbr \u002F>\nImage is created on the fly via PHP and inserted as inline image directly to src attribute of img tag.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Ch4>Credit\u003C\u002Fh4>\n\u003Cp>Thanks to Masau ( http:\u002F\u002Fjsfiddle.net\u002FMasau\u002F7WRHM\u002F ) for the “trick”.\u003C\u002Fp>\n","This is simple shortcode to embed responsive (fixed-ratio) iframes",10,1821,80,1,"2013-11-01T08:08:00.000Z","3.7.41","3.3.1","",[20,21],"iframe","responsive","http:\u002F\u002Fgit.ladasoukup.cz\u002Fsb-responseframe","https:\u002F\u002Fdownloads.wordpress.org\u002Fplugin\u002Fsb-responseframe.zip",85,0,null,"2026-03-15T15:16:48.613Z",[],{"slug":30,"display_name":7,"profile_url":8,"plugin_count":31,"total_installs":32,"avg_security_score":24,"avg_patch_time_days":33,"trust_score":34,"computed_at":35},"ladislavsoukupgmailcom",4,1030,30,84,"2026-04-04T22:35:51.242Z",[37,58,75,90,107],{"slug":38,"name":39,"version":40,"author":41,"author_profile":42,"description":43,"short_description":44,"active_installs":45,"downloaded":46,"rating":34,"num_ratings":47,"last_updated":48,"tested_up_to":49,"requires_at_least":50,"requires_php":18,"tags":51,"homepage":55,"download_link":56,"security_score":57,"vuln_count":25,"unpatched_count":25,"last_vuln_date":26,"fetched_at":27},"simple-youtube-embed","Simple YouTube Embed","1.1.0.5","Noor Alam","https:\u002F\u002Fprofiles.wordpress.org\u002Fnaa986\u002F","\u003Cp>\u003Ca href=\"https:\u002F\u002Fnoorsplugin.com\u002Fsimple-youtube-embed-plugin\u002F\" rel=\"nofollow ugc\">Simple YouTube Embed\u003C\u002Fa> plugin is the easiest way to embed YouTube videos in WordPress. Gutenberg brings its own CSS for responsive oEmbed elements, so this plugin would double that and create strange effects.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>This plugin uses some minimal CSS rules and a wrapping HTML element to maintain the aspect ratio of oEmbed elements with fixed aspect ratio (e. g. YouTube, Vimeo or Soundcloud).\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>Unlike other plugins, this plugin does not use any JavaScript!\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>The aspect ratio is calculated from the (iframe, object or embed) HTML tag width and height attributes. An aspect ratio will only be applied, if both width AND height attributes are given by the oEmbed element and if there is no data-secret attribut set (because those are handled via wp-embed.js). Some oEmbeds have no width or height attributes set, because they calculate their dimension via JavaScript. In those cases this plugin has no effect.\u003C\u002Fp>\n\u003Cp>You can find a \u003Ca href=\"https:\u002F\u002Fcodex.wordpress.org\u002FEmbeds#Okay.2C_So_What_Sites_Can_I_Embed_From.3F\" rel=\"nofollow ugc\">list of all oEmbed sites supported by WordPress here\u003C\u002Fa>.\u003C\u002Fp>\n","Makes oEmbed elements with fixed aspect ratio (like YouTube, Vimeo or SoundCloud) scale responsively.",3340,74,3,"2019-03-03T12:43:00.000Z","5.1.22","4.0",[104,20,105,21,54],"aspect-ratio","oembed","https:\u002F\u002Fdownloads.wordpress.org\u002Fplugin\u002Fresponsive-oembed.1.4.1.zip",{"slug":108,"name":109,"version":110,"author":111,"author_profile":112,"description":113,"short_description":114,"active_installs":115,"downloaded":116,"rating":25,"num_ratings":25,"last_updated":117,"tested_up_to":118,"requires_at_least":119,"requires_php":120,"tags":121,"homepage":125,"download_link":126,"security_score":24,"vuln_count":25,"unpatched_count":25,"last_vuln_date":26,"fetched_at":27},"pym-shortcode","Pym.js Embeds","1.3.2.4","Automattic","https:\u002F\u002Fprofiles.wordpress.org\u002Fautomattic\u002F","\u003Cp>Pym.js Embeds provides shortcode and Gutenberg block wrappers for embedding responsive iframes using \u003Ca href=\"http:\u002F\u002Fblog.apps.npr.org\u002Fpym.js\u002F\" rel=\"nofollow ugc\">Pym.js\u003C\u002Fa>, developed by the NPR Visuals Team. The absence of dangerous functions, file operations, external HTTP requests, and a complete reliance on prepared statements for SQL queries are all excellent security practices. The fact that all analyzed outputs are properly escaped further bolsters this positive assessment.  The limited attack surface, consisting of a single shortcode with no identified unprotected entry points, also contributes to a low risk profile.  Furthermore, the plugin's vulnerability history is clean, with no recorded CVEs, which suggests a history of secure development.  However, the complete lack of nonce checks and capability checks across all identified entry points is a significant concern. While the attack surface is small, any future vulnerabilities or modifications could be exploited if these fundamental security mechanisms are not implemented.  This absence represents a potential weakness that could be leveraged if other security measures were to fail or be bypassed.",[150,153],{"reason":151,"points":152},"Missing nonce checks on entry points",5,{"reason":154,"points":152},"Missing capability checks on entry points","2026-03-17T01:08:18.226Z",{"wat":157,"direct":162},{"assetPaths":158,"generatorPatterns":159,"scriptPaths":160,"versionParams":161},[],[],[],[],{"cssClasses":163,"htmlComments":164,"htmlAttributes":165,"restEndpoints":167,"jsGlobals":168,"shortcodeOutput":169},[],[],[166],"data-ratio",[],[],[170,171,172,173,174,175,176],"\u003Cdiv style=\"width:","height:100%;margin:0 auto;\">","\u003Cdiv style=\"position:relative;\">","\u003Cimg src=\"data:image\u002Fpng;base64,","style=\"display:block;width:100%;height:auto;\"","\u003Ciframe src=\"","frameborder=\"0\" allowfullscreen style=\"position:absolute;top:0;left:0;width:100%; height:100%;\">\u003C\u002Fiframe>"]
